KJ Apa Doesn't View Himself as a Singer & Was Scared to Sing in 'I Still Believe'

The 22-year-old actor can currently be seen in the movie I Still Believe, which is available for streaming right now. Here’s what he shared with the mag:

On his career trajectory: “Every time I try and plan my career out, something comes by that completely throws me off, like a faith-based movie. Never did I ever, one, want to do a faith-based movie or two, imagine myself doing one. But that made me realize that it’s not about that. It’s about what inspires you. I hope that I can keep having opportunities to do work on projects that I’m inspired by. I feel like, at the end of the day, if you’re doing that, then you’re winning in life.”

On having to sing in I Still Believe: “The music was also one of the things that had me second guessing myself. I don’t see myself as a singer. Even still I don’t. I was scared to sing. But I was like, ‘F–k it. I’m just going to do it. I’m going to give it a go.’”

On being in the spotlight: “It was [something I saw for myself], which is weird. Not to be famous, but I always knew as a kid that I wasn’t going to be in New Zealand, that I was going to leave at an early age, and that I wasn’t going to do what everyone else was doing.”
